ANDREA PESCHEL SWAN

ANDREA PESCHEL SWAN

AIA

  • Registered Architect in Minnesota and New York since 2003
  • 26 Years Professional Experience
  • Extensive experience in Residential Design, as well as experience in Town Planning, Commercial, Office, Recreational and Civic Architecture.
  • Certificate Holder, NCARB
  • Member, American Institute of Architects (AIA)
  • Member, Institute of Classical Architecture & Classical America
  • AIA MPLS Chapter Board, past Director

Andrea's passion for architecture began at young age while spending summers in Europe - her parents immigrated from Slovakia, and her family still resides throughout Europe.

After graduating from Visitation High School located in Mendota Heights, MN, Andrea earned her Bachelor of Architecture degree from the University of Notre Dame, including a year at the School of Architecture's Rome Studies Center. Andrea's classical training led her to New York City where she performed her internship and established licensure while devoting more than half-a-decade at the renowned firm of Cooper, Robertson & Partners. Andrea practiced at TEA2 Architects in Minneapolis before founding Swan Architecture in 2009.

CARLOS BRAVO

CARLOS BRAVO

ASSOC. AIA

  • Bachelor of Architecture, University of Michoacan
  • 27 Years of Professional Experience
  • 20 Years of Work in Residential Architecture
  • 8 Years as Revit Manager
  • 5 Years of work in Commercial Architecture

Carlos earned his 5 yr. Bachelor of Architecture degree from the University of Michoacan in Morelia, Mexico. After graduating he first worked for a residential design and build firm, and then joined one of the largest theater design companies, Cinepolis, creating prototypes for movie complexes in Mexico and Ecuador.

After moving to the United States in 2000, he worked with Brown and Bills Architects in Dayton Ohio; Then after moving to Minnesota he devoted over a decade working with Aulik and Associates, a residential design and build company.

By working in different global locations, Carlos has acquired a diverse knowledge in residential design and different construction systems.

JOE PAETZEL

JOE PAETZEL

AIA

  • Registered Architect in Minnesota
  • Masters of Architecture Degree, University of Minnesota
  • B.S. - Architecture, University of Minnesota
  • 23 Years of Professional Experience
  • Certificate Holder, NCARB
  • Member, American Institute of Architects (AIA)

Joe grew up in the northern suburbs of Minneapolis and spent his childhood drawing and thinking of being an architect one day. While on break from college, he took an entry level job for a prominent design/build firm on Lake Minnetonka. After spending a few years in the trenches learning about construction he moved into the office and started doing computer aided drafting. At about the same time, he went back to college to pursue his goal of becoming an architect. He worked his way through college, gaining both a theoretical knowledge of design and a practical knowledge of construction along the way.

Audy Bachrain

AUDY BACHRAIN

ASSOC. AIA

  • Bachelor of Architecture Degree from Deakin University, Melbourne Australia
  • 9 Years of Professional Experience
  • 5 Years of Experience in Residential Design

Audy hails from Balikpapan, a small coastal town in Indonesia where he spent most of his childhood. In his final year of high school, he seized the opportunity to join an exchange student program in the United Kingdom. This experience ignited his passion in Architecture, and guided him to pursue a degree in Architecture and Building design in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ia before completing his Bachelor’s degree in Melbourne, Australia.

His professional experience is diverse including work in design studios in Australia, Indonesia, and Malaysia. He believes People, Culture and Architecture are inseparable and HOME is where everything starts.

Julia Severson

Julia Severson

AIA

  • Bachelor of Architecture, University of Notre Dame
  • Registered Architect
  • Certificate Holder, NCARB
  • 7 years of Experience in Residential Design
  • Member, American Institute of Architects (AIA)

Julia grew up in the Midwestern heartland of Indiana, earning her bachelor’s degree in architecture from the University of Notre Dame.

She was fascinated by art, architecture, and textiles from a young age, and her curiosity about architecture was further ignited during her travels in Spain and Italy. This love for travel and design led her to move to New York City after graduation, where she began her career at Fairfax & Sammons Architects. Following her time in New York, Julia further enriched her experience at a high-end residential architecture and interiors firm in Chicago.

She joined Swan Architecture in 2022, working part-time while raising her three young daughters. Katy Dale

Katy Dale

Assoc. AIA

  • Masters of Architecture, College of Desing and University of Minnesota
  • Bachelor of Science in Architecture, University of Minnesota
  • 22+ years professional experience
  • 11+ years residential experience
  • Member, American Institute of Architects (AIA)

Katy grew up in Bloomington, Minnesota, her grandfather was a structural engineer and her parents were always dreaming up and building something. This exposure led to an early passion for shaping the world around her.

She holds degrees in Architecture from the University of Minnesota and has been working in the field since 2002. After finishing her masters, Katy spent many years at Christian Dean Architecture, a small creative practice focused on modern residences and boutique commercial projects. With a desire to better understand construction, she transitioned to design-build firms. Working in close collaboration with building specialists accelerated her knowledge of construction methods, detailing and cost drivers.

In her design work, Katy derives inspiration from the uniqueness of each client and strives to integrate her training and experience to develop elegant design solutions that speak to each client’s goals with thoughtful consideration of context, function, materiality and craft.
